荷兰Groasis保水节水造林技术在民勤荒漠区的应用

摘    要:目的]研究荷兰Groasis(水盒子)在民勤荒漠区保水节水造林的初步应用,为荒漠区困难立地条件下进行大规模的节水造林和农业推广提供参考数据。方法]选择了11种荒漠植物造林树种,在民勤沙区的退耕地、丘间地、引种圃3种类型的田间进行试验,测定成活率、土壤水分等。结果](1)11种抗风沙树种在退耕地的土壤含水率的高低顺序为:沙拐枣花棒毛条柽柳沙地云杉樟子松胡杨蒙古扁桃沙棘榆树沙枣。(2)各种抗风沙树种在典型的3种土壤类型中,利用水盒子栽培的土壤含水率明显高于普通栽培的土壤,要高出2~5倍。(3)不同抗风沙树种和蔬菜利用水盒子在3种典型土壤类型中成活率比对照不同程度提高25%~70%左右。结论]利用水盒子可以有效地提高抗风沙树种的成活率。

Application of Groasis Water-saving Afforestation Technology of Holland in Minqin Desert Area

Abstract:Objective] To study the application of Groasis(water-box) technique of Holland in the afforestation in Minqin desert area, we aimed to provide reference data for larger scale water-saving afforestation in desert areas.Methods] By choosing 11 afforestation tree species, fields tests were conducted in returning land, inter dunes and introduction garden in Minqin desert area. The survival rate, soil moisture of these tree species were measured as well.Results] The results showed that:(1) Soil moisture content of 11 afforestation tree species in abandoned farmland was Calligonum mongolicum >Hedysarum scoparium >Caragana korshinskii >Tamarix chinensis >Picea mongolica >Pinus sylvestris >Populus euphratica >Amygdalus mongolica >Hippophae rhamnoides >Ulmus pumila >Elaeagnus angustifolia.(2) Within all 3 soil types, the moisture content in the sand resist trees cultivated by water-box was 2 to 5 times higher than that in the normal cultivation.(3) The survival rate in all sand resist trees cultivated by water-box was improved by 25% to 70%, compared with the normal cultivation.Conclusion] The water-box can effectively improve the water use efficiency for the sand resist tree species.
